计算机模块编程软件叫什么
-
计算机模块编程软件通常被称为集成开发环境(Integrated Development Environment,简称IDE)。IDE是一种软件应用程序,旨在为程序员提供一个便捷的开发环境,其中包括编写、调试和测试代码的工具。
IDE通常由以下几个主要模块组成:
-
代码编辑器:用于编写和编辑源代码。它通常具有语法高亮、自动完成和错误检查等功能,以提高开发效率。
-
编译器/解释器:用于将源代码转换为可执行文件或解释执行。编译器将源代码编译成机器语言,而解释器则逐行解释执行源代码。
-
调试器:用于调试代码,帮助开发人员查找和修复错误。调试器通常提供断点、单步执行、变量监视等功能,以帮助程序员理解代码的执行过程。
-
版本控制系统:用于跟踪和管理代码的版本。版本控制系统允许多个开发者协同工作,管理代码的修改和合并。
-
构建工具:用于自动化构建和部署应用程序。构建工具可以编译、打包和发布代码,以减少手动操作并提高效率。
常见的计算机模块编程软件包括Visual Studio、Eclipse、IntelliJ IDEA、PyCharm、Xcode等。这些IDE提供了丰富的功能和插件,适用于各种编程语言和平台,如C++、Java、Python、iOS等。开发人员可以根据自己的需求选择适合自己的IDE进行开发工作。
1年前 -
-
计算机模块编程软件有很多种,以下是其中一些常见的软件:
-
Arduino IDE(集成开发环境):Arduino是一种开源电子原型平台,它使用简单的硬件和软件组件,可以编写和上传代码到Arduino板上。Arduino IDE是用于编写和上传代码的官方软件。
-
Raspberry Pi(树莓派):树莓派是一种小型的基于Linux的计算机,它可以用于多种应用,如学习编程、DIY项目、嵌入式系统等。Raspberry Pi可以使用各种编程语言进行编程,如Python、C++等。
-
MATLAB(矩阵实验室):MATLAB是一种用于数值计算和数据可视化的高级编程语言和环境。它广泛用于科学和工程领域,可以进行算法开发、数据分析、图像处理等。
-
LabVIEW(实验室虚拟仪器工程师):LabVIEW是一种图形化编程环境,用于控制和测量系统。它适用于各种领域,如自动化、测试和测量、数据采集等。
-
Scratch(刮刮乐):Scratch是一种用于学习编程的图形化编程语言和环境。它适用于初学者,可以通过拖拽和连接模块来编写程序,培养逻辑思维和创造力。
-
Unity(统一游戏引擎):Unity是一种用于游戏开发的跨平台游戏引擎。它提供了丰富的开发工具和模块,可以用C#或JavaScript编写游戏逻辑。
这些软件都提供了丰富的模块和功能,可以帮助用户进行各种编程任务,从简单的电子项目到复杂的科学计算和游戏开发。
1年前 -
-
计算机模块编程软件通常被称为集成开发环境(Integrated Development Environment,简称IDE)。IDE是一种软件应用程序,旨在为程序员提供一个统一的界面来编写、调试和部署软件应用程序。IDE通常包含多个工具和功能,以提高开发效率,并为程序员提供各种工具和资源来编写高质量的代码。
下面是一些常见的计算机模块编程软件(IDE):
-
Visual Studio:Visual Studio是由微软公司开发的集成开发环境。它支持多种编程语言,包括C++、C#、VB.NET等。Visual Studio提供了丰富的功能,如代码编辑器、调试器、版本控制、图形化界面设计工具等。
-
Eclipse:Eclipse是一款开放源代码的集成开发环境,主要用于Java开发。它支持多种编程语言,包括Java、C++、Python等。Eclipse具有强大的代码编辑器、调试器、项目管理工具等功能,并且可以通过插件扩展功能。
-
Xcode:Xcode是苹果公司开发的集成开发环境,主要用于开发iOS和macOS应用程序。它支持多种编程语言,包括Objective-C、Swift等。Xcode提供了丰富的工具和资源,如代码编辑器、界面设计工具、模拟器等。
-
Android Studio:Android Studio是谷歌公司为Android开发者提供的集成开发环境。它基于IntelliJ IDEA开发,并专门用于开发Android应用程序。Android Studio提供了丰富的工具和资源,如代码编辑器、布局编辑器、虚拟设备等。
-
IntelliJ IDEA:IntelliJ IDEA是一款由JetBrains公司开发的集成开发环境,主要用于Java开发。它提供了强大的代码编辑器、智能代码补全、重构工具等功能,并支持多种编程语言。
除了以上提到的IDE,还有许多其他的计算机模块编程软件可供选择,如NetBeans、PyCharm等。程序员可以根据自己的需求和喜好选择适合自己的IDE来进行模块编程。
1年前 -